▸ View Original Clause Language DOCUMENT RECORD
"
We may also terminate your Account if you have been inactive for over a year and you do not have a paid Account. If we terminate your Account due to inactivity, we will provide you with notice before d...

— Excerpt from Anthropic's Anthropic API Terms
